EA triples down on AI tech with $20 billion in debt looming, partnering with Stable Diffusion devs

For better or worse, EA has been at the forefront of implementing machine learning technology in game development, and its investment in AI isn't about to change as the company soon comes under new ownership. With $20 billion in debt looming as part of that big buyout, EA has now announced a collaboration with Stability AI to implement a range of new AI technologies in its development process.

Spiders Studio, Developers of GreedFall: The Dying World, Announce Liquidation of the Company

Spiders: "We're going to cut straight to the chase so you're not left wondering: After a long period without clear answers, we have received confirmation that Spiders is being liquidated.

What does it mean? This means the company as a whole no longer exists. We'll cease our functions immediately. The planned DLC will release via Nacon, and then-- well, that's it.

We're sorry that it's come to this and would like to thank each and every one of you for your support over the years.

If you have any questions or run into issues with your games, please contact Nacon directly as we'll no longer be able to reply."
